Hitting back at Prime Minister Narendra Modi for calling him ‘U-Turn Babu’, Chief Minister N Chandrababu who has been rallying regional parties to form an anti-BJP front, on Monday said it was not him but the BJP government which did not fulfill its promise of special status to Andhra Pradesh.

During an interview to media, the Telugu Desam Party (TDP) chief, who is eyeing the role of kingmaker at the Centre, said that any leader could be "a better prime minister than Modi" and that a PM should be “a statesman and not a narrow-minded leader like him”. He also said Modi is a terrorist. A day after Prime Minister Narendra Modi compared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ister to blockbuster "Baahubali" movie's primary antagonist Bhallala Deva, Naidu retorted by calling the Prime Minister a terrorist.

“What happened during that time in Godhra? 2,000 people were massacred. That day I had said that Narendra Modi is not fit to live in this country. I am letting you all know that I was the first person to demand his resignation. After that, every country said no to his entry," Naidu said. Earlier on April 1, Prime Minister Modi repeatedly called the Telugu Desam Party (TDP) chief 'U-turn Babu' and alleged that the TDP has been involved in stealing people's data.
